Quando o assunto é banco de dados, um dos conceitos que você precisa aprender é o que é MySQL.
Afinal, esse é um dos modelos mais famosos de gestão de dados, sendo usado por empresas de diferentes portes, desde de pequenas operações até empresas que trabalham com grandes volumes de dados como bancos e grandes negócios de tecnologia.
Ao oferecer vantagens como segurança e flexibilidade de uso, a ferramenta se destaca no mercado e chama a atenção de quem começa a pesquisar sobre soluções de gerenciamento de informações.
Isso porque o cuidado com dados empresariais, de clientes e transações, é vital para a manutenção de qualquer companhia, sendo previsto em leis como a LGPD, ou Lei Geral de Proteção de Dados.
Também é importante reforçar que a perda ou a divulgação de dados, seja por falhas no sistema ou invasões hackers, pode destruir a reputação de um negócio e gerar prejuízos milionários.
Diante de tudo isso, a escolha de um bom sistema de gerenciamento de dados é essencial. Nesse cenário, surge o que é MySQL.
O que é MySQL?
MySQL é um sistema de gerenciamento de banco de dados relacional (SGBDR ou, em inglês, RDBMS – Relational Database Management Systems) que utiliza a Linguagem de Consulta Estruturada (SQL). Na prática, o MySQL é um sistema de código aberto para a gestão de base de dados.
O modelo está entre os mais instalados mundo afora e uma das razões para isso é a sua capacidade de integração com várias linguagens de programação e sistemas operacionais, como:
- PHP;
- Python;
- Java;
- NET e muitas outras.
Além disso, um dos pontos principais que mais atraem adeptos é o fato de ser um banco de “open source”, ou seja, o código é aberto e, por isso, pode ser facilmente personalizado.
Também é importante destacar que a ferramenta é concedida por ser de uso fácil, prático e completo, permitindo o gerenciamento de dados com muitas soluções em relação a:
- auditoria;
- particionamento;
- replicação nativa;
- segurança.
Mas, afinal, como tudo isso funciona na prática, dentro do dia a dia das companhias? Para que serve o MySQL?
Para que serve o MySQL?
O MySQL serve para armazenar, gerenciar e recuperar dados de forma eficiente. Um banco de dados é uma coleção organizada de informações estruturadas e relacionadas, que podem ser acessadas a partir de um sistema eletrônico, como um computador. Com uma boa ferramenta é possível ter acesso rápido e seguro aos dados.
Para que fique mais fácil entender, pense no banco de dados como a galeria de fotos do seu celular. Enquanto uma imagem é um dado, a galeria é o banco de dados.
Ela é o lugar em que a foto ficou armazenada e por onde ela pode ser acessada.
E, como dissemos acima, o MySQL é um banco de dados relacional, o que significa que os dados são organizados dentro dele, em tabelas que podem criar relações entre si.
Por exemplo, em um sistema de gestão de dados MySQL, é possível ter uma tabela para clientes, que vai organizar nome, endereço e telefone dos compradores da empresa. Ao mesmo tempo, ter outra tabela, que armazena os pedidos, seus valores e descrição.
Ao acessar o banco de dados é possível fazer pesquisas complexas que envolvam informações das duas tabelas e apresentam, por exemplo, os pedidos feitos por cada cliente.
Ou seja, as informações são organizadas em tabelas, mas elas podem se comunicar e relacionar de acordo com a maneira que o usuário deseja acessar seus elementos.
Leia também: Boas Práticas para Gerenciamento de Dados do Cliente
Como usar MySQL?
O MySQL pode ser usado de diferentes formas, incluindo:
- banco de dados para aplicativos, armazenando dados de usuários, produtos, login e comentários;
- armazenar posts, páginas, categorias e outros elementos de sites em sistemas de gerenciamento de conteúdo (CMS) como o WordPress;
- guardar e gerenciar grandes volumes de dados para empresas;
- plataforma para análise de dados, facilitando consultas complexas e geração de relatórios;
- coletar e registrar dados de ecommerce e mais.
Leia também: Gerenciando Dados do Cliente: Dicas e Ferramentas Para Qualquer Orçamento
Vantagens e desvantagens do MySQL
Quem sabe o que é MySQL e conhece suas peculiaridades, entende que o único ponto menos atrativo é o que diz respeito à complexidade de personalização, pois requer conhecimentos mais avançados.
Por outro lado, ele se destaca quando o assunto são vantagens relacionadas a:
- segurança de dados;
- integridade;
- desempenho.
Além disso, o sistema conta com controle de acesso dos usuários e com backups simples e recorrentes, assim, é considerado mais seguro para quem o utiliza.
É de fácil integração com diferentes tipos de sistemas e também apresenta respostas rápidas.
Outros benefícios incluem flexibilidade, facilidade de uso e alto desempenho
Ou seja, é um verdadeiro aliado de desenvolvedores, já que a agilidade no carregamento é cada vez mais exigida.
Depois de saber o que é MySQL, quais os próximos passos?
Agora que você já sabe o que é MySQL e possivelmente já decidiu se irá utilizá-lo como seu gerenciador de banco de dados, o próximo passo é buscar mais informações sobre a importação de arquivos no sistema.
Aproveite para conhecer todas as soluções digitais da GoDaddy para sites e outros canais, incluindo:
- compra e registro de domínio;
- hospedagem;
- e-mail marketing;
- SEO e muito mais.
Potencialize seu projeto ou empreendimento e cresça em seu ramo de atuação ao lado da líder do mercado!
Caso deseje obter um aprofundamento em conteúdos técnicos, confira os outros artigos do nosso blog.